Madness in the Bundesliga. Stuttgart and Union score 8 goals in the first half


In the 30th round of the German Bundesliga, an incredible event took place. In Berlin, Union and Stuttgart delivered a true spectacle to the fans, scoring eight goals in the first 45 minutes.
By the 19th minute, the hosts were already leading 2-0, but the "Swabians" needed just ten minutes to catch up. At the end of the half, the opponents scored two more goals each, heading into the break with an astonishing 4-4 scoreline.
This match is sure to go down in Bundesliga history. According to the statistical portal Opta Franz, it is the first time in the tournament's history that as many as eight goals were scored in the first 45 minutes.
Interestingly, the teams made ten shots on target between them. Meanwhile, the expected goals (xG) was only 1.75 — 1.00 for Union and 0.75 for Stuttgart.
